Veteran Ghanaian actor and news anchor, Akwasi Boadi, popularly known as Akrobeto has revealed the reason why the local Ghanaian movie industry has lost it relevance and till date everyone has lost interest in it.

He said that the genesis of their problems started when there was a low power supply in the country (Dumsor) and this according to him rendered most of the actors jobless.

In an interview with Nana Ama Mcbrown on the United Showbiz, Akrobeto said that “Dumsor” was the main reason why most local movie industry productions stopped making movies. He said that “Dumsor” made it impossible for them to work and caused low patronage of local movie contents.

“Dumsor was a big problem to our work. It was the beginning of our owoes because we weren’t able to work as we used to do.”

“People could not even watch movies they buy and we weren’t able to churn out more content for our viewers,”he said.

He also said that Ghanaians always complained about the low quality level of the local movie contents of which he admitted and said that though the local movie industry is not moving in the direction they desired but he believes with the use of modern technology, they can still come back and produce better movies.
